The IPX515 Top is marketed primarily for water resistance, not dust. The manufacturer opted for an acoustic mesh on the speaker grilles that excels at repelling water but allows microscopic dust particles to pass through over time. For 99% of users (urban commuters, gym-goers, swimmers), this is fine.
